no. 2 Embodiment approach
[0097] Below, refer to Figure 4 An example of the cable portion in the ultrasonic probe according to the second embodiment of the present invention will be described.
[0098] Figure 4 It is a sectional view showing the cable portion of the ultrasonic probe according to the second embodiment of the present invention. Figure 4 The ultrasonic probe of the second embodiment shown is different from the ultrasonic probe of the first embodiment shown in FIG. 2 in that the refrigerant pipe portion is replaced with a porous pipe having four independent holes in the longitudinal direction.
[0099] The cable portion 2b has a circular cross section, and a porous tube 22b having a circular cross section is disposed near the center of the cross section. no. 3 Embodiment approach
[0104] Below, refer to Figure 5 An ultrasonic probe according to a third embodiment of the present invention will be described.
[0105] Figure 5 It is a sectional view showing the cable portion of the ultrasonic probe according to the third embodiment of the present invention. Figure 5 The ultrasonic probe according to the third embodiment shown in FIG. 2 is different from the ultrasonic probe according to the first embodiment shown in FIG. 2 in that the refrigerant discharge pipe is provided away from the center of the cable portion.
[0106] The cross section of the cable portion 2c is circular, and the refrigerant supply pipe 23c is disposed near the center of the cross section. A plurality of signal lines 21 are arranged on the outer periphery of the refrigerant supply pipe 23 c, and shielded wires 26 of the signal lines 21 are arranged on the outer periphery of the signal lines 21 .
